Alan Banks, CEO at industry association TechWorks, sat down with DIGIT to discuss use cases for deep tech, Britain’s standing on the world stage, and what the future holds.

The UK can arguably be viewed as a global leadership contender in technological innovation, proving itself in areas including artificial intelligence, fintech and electric vehicles.

One thing that can’t be argued against is that the tech sector here is growing rapidly, and a lot of the leading solutions and innovations in this space are being driven by the burgeoning UK deep tech sector.

Deep tech is having a profound impact on areas such as medical devices, clean tech, energy efficiency, autonomous systems, robotics, and smart homes/cities.

The term itself is best described as technology that is based on tangible engineering innovation or scientific advances and discoveries. It can span across many technological areas and impact diverse applications.

Britain is fast becoming a breeding ground for deep tech companies, with the hope being that nurturing this space can fortify the UK as a leading player in global tech country in a strong position to fortify itself as a leading player in global tech.

Alan Banks, CEO at tech industry association TechWorks, spoke to DIGIT about how the the country should carry this out, and where the UK deep tech sector could be utilised to solve some of the planet’s biggest problems.


Where do we sit on the global tech stage?

Britain has historically had strong research and innovation in universities, as well as a track record of firms investing in research and development (R&D), which has steadily increased over time. 

The UK government has been supportive of R&D and is helping with competition programmes like Innovate UK, DCMS, and supporting research, development, and collaboration programmes.

Additionally, the government has stated it wants the UK to become a technology superpower in the future. However, without strong investment, it will be difficult for this goal to be achieved.

Banks comments: “Since 2015, global investment in deep tech has increased about 20% year-on-year, and the UK shares some of this investment, and investment in UK deep tech sector companies has continued to grow rapidly over the last five years, rising by 291% to 2.3 billion of investment in 2020.”

According to Banks, Scotland can also be singled out for praise within the UK, with the country’s digital technologies currently prospering  and growing one and a half times faster than the overall economy. Banks expands on this, saying: “The deep tech sector in general is thriving”.

He continues: “There’s a very large number of long-established SMEs and companies. But over 25% of high-growth companies in Scotland are deep tech companies.”

He adds: “The industry is huge globally, and Scotland has a strong base in medical technology, photonics, space development, underwater technologies, defence, as well as the oil and gas industries, all of which are now starting to have certain challenges as things are changing around them and they start to embrace some of these deep tech resolutions to solve some of their challenges.”

According to Banks, Scotland continues to be a leading place for investment around AI, with the country being home to many firms specialising in this field being founded here, particularly in Edinburgh.

Tech education is also flourishing in Scotland, Banks says, adding: “Scotland continues to have a number of very strong universities that are very supportive of research and development, and that then leads to spin outs, so we’re seeing a number of spin outs from these universities.”

Banks also notes a recently approved government investment into several technology hubs in Scotland, and Edinburgh is seen as a top city for startups in the UK, with a very high growth potential. Glasgow also remains one of the UK’s biggest investment hubs for deep tech.


Use cases for deep tech

It is positive to hear that technological innovation is thriving, both in Scotland and the UK, particularly as we look towards tech to help solve future global issues.

Industry leaders, policymakers, academics, and researchers agree that, globally, we urgently need to introduce deep tech to boost productivity and solve some of the most pressing challenges facing society today.

Banks references spin out companies and small SMEs in England that are leading DNA sequencing, as well as data gathering companies conducting world-leading research in disease prevention, including cyclic scientific diagnosis for the diagnosis and prevention of cancer.

He continues: “We also have leading companies developing agritech, ensuring that we maximise the yield on our crops and get food into the supply chain as fast as we can and in the most sustainable way that we can.

“As society continues to solve the challenges of things like ageing, population, global warming, and loneliness, deep tech is going to become more vital.”

Emerging tech, such as quantum computing and AI, will enable for solutions to be found for these large-scale societal problems, Banks muses.


Challenges facing deep tech adoption

However, a growing the UK deep tech sector does not come without a set of challenges, Banks notes.

Firstly, energy requirements. Powering cutting-edge technology is demanding and will require more and more computing power and infrastructure.

“More computing power means you will need faster chips, faster processes, and they generate a lot of heat, or they reach the limitations of physics, so you must start looking at new technologies,” he says.

Banks adds: “I think there are technology challenges, but a lot of this has been overcome when you introduce things like quantum computing. I think this will be a game changer, but it also will introduce significant other challenges.”

Additionally, finding investment in the UK can be difficult. Strong intellectual property, and a desire for tech advancement, means firms can easily access initial startup investment.

However, once they go for their second round of investment, difficulty in scaling and general investment attitudes in the UK mean they often struggle, and many firms end up moving offshore.

A report last year found that UK deep tech firms were less likely to raise a second round of funding than their US counterparts: only 49% of UK startups received ‘follow-on funding’ compared to 63% of companies based in the US.

Due to this, 39% of deep tech businesses in the UK run out of investment before they raise a second round of capital.

“I think one of the challenges that we have is how do we retain the technology development that we have an intellectual property that’s been created in the UK software going offshore as it matures?” Banks asks.


Deep tech’s role in the UK’s future

Despite the challenges, Banks eyes an opportunity for Britain to cement itself as a global leader in deep tech rollout.

He notes, however, a need to continue ensuring the UK tech sector is attractive for investment, and to continue this investment throughout the lifecycle, from development through to implementation.

Tech Nation previously made the bold statement that deep tech “sits at the heart of the UK’s tech future,” and Banks agrees.

On this, he says: “We have our top-flight universities, we have leading technology companies, and the government support that we get gives us the opportunity to be a leading technology country,” he says.

“But we must value – and I underscore this – we must value the people and the technology that’s developed, be proud of it, keep it here in the UK, and find mechanisms and tools that really make us very proud of what we do here, and be patriotic about it!”

Banks concludes: “We are at the centre of our technical future. But we’ve got to make sure we hang on to it to make the UK as prosperous as it can be.”
